Rove reportedly pushing Romney for McCain's VP

Submitted by lucidity on Thu, 08/28/2008 - 10:54am.

Remember, this is the guy who sincerely thought the Republicans would keep control of Congress in 2006 (Politico):

"Rove is pushing Romney so aggressively some folks are beginning to wonder what's going on," grumbled one veteran Republican strategist.

From his perch on Fox, Rove has touted McCain's fierce primary rival as strong vice presidential material.

"Romney is already vetted by the media, has strong executive experience both in business and in government, has an interesting story to tell with saving the U.S. Olympics, and also helps McCain deal with the economy, because he can speak to the economy with a fluency that McCain doesn't have," Rove said on "Fox News Sunday" in June.

But conservative evangelicals hate the Mittster. Has Rove decided the Religious Right doesn't matter anymore?
